What Makes an Extender an AC 1900?
An AC 1900 extender is designed to enhance wireless network performance, providing a robust connection ideal for streaming and gaming. The key features that define an AC 1900 extender are:
- Dual-Band Technology: AC 1900 extenders operate on both the 2.4 GHz and 5 GHz frequency bands, allowing devices to connect on the band that is less congested. This dual-band capability ensures better performance and reduced interference, making it suitable for activities like HD streaming and online gaming.
- Data Transfer Rate: The “1900” in AC 1900 refers to the combined maximum data transfer rate of 1900 Mbps across both bands (up to 600 Mbps on 2.4 GHz and 1300 Mbps on 5 GHz). This high-speed capability supports multiple devices simultaneously without compromising the speed, providing a seamless internet experience.
- Enhanced Coverage: AC 1900 extenders are equipped with advanced antennas and technology that extend the range of your Wi-Fi network. This means they can eliminate dead zones in larger homes, ensuring a strong and stable connection throughout the living space.
- Beamforming Technology: Many AC 1900 extenders utilize beamforming technology, which focuses the Wi-Fi signal directly to connected devices rather than broadcasting it in all directions. This targeted approach enhances connection stability and speed, particularly for devices that are further away from the router.
- Easy Setup and Management: Most AC 1900 extenders come with user-friendly setup processes, often using mobile apps or web interfaces. This simplicity allows users to manage their network settings, monitor device connections, and optimize performance without technical expertise.

Why Is Dual-Band Wi-Fi Important for Home Use?
Dual-band Wi-Fi is essential for enhancing home networking due to its ability to operate on two distinct frequency bands—2.4 GHz and 5 GHz. Each band serves unique purposes, making them beneficial for a variety of devices and use cases.
Advantages of Dual-Band Wi-Fi:
-
Reduced Interference: The 2.4 GHz band is susceptible to interference from other household devices like microwaves and wireless phones, while the 5 GHz band offers a cleaner signal with less congestion, ideal for devices that require faster speeds.
-
Improved Speed: The 5 GHz band supports higher speeds, making it perfect for activities such as online gaming, video conferencing, and streaming HD content. For everyday tasks like browsing or checking emails, the 2.4 GHz band suffices, allowing you to maintain a strong connection across multiple devices.
-
Better Device Management: Dual-band extenders can intelligently distribute traffic between bands. High-bandwidth devices can connect to the 5 GHz band, freeing up the 2.4 GHz band for others, ensuring optimal performance without slowdowns.
Implementing a dual-band extender, like the AC 1900, allows a seamless experience across different devices, catering to varying needs while maintaining reliable connectivity throughout the home.

Where Should You Place Your AC 1900 Extender for Optimal Coverage?
Elevating the extender can also make a substantial difference in its effectiveness; Wi-Fi signals spread better in open air, and placing the extender higher can help reduce interference from furniture and other obstacles, leading to improved signal quality.
Avoiding obstacles is essential, as physical barriers can weaken the Wi-Fi signal. By ensuring that your extender is not obstructed by walls, large furniture, or appliances, you will maximize its potential to spread a strong signal throughout your living space.
Proximity to power outlets is another factor to consider; having your extender close to an outlet minimizes the risk of using long cords that could create hazards and might also introduce interference. A direct connection to the power source ensures a stable operation.
For multi-story homes, a central location for the extender—either on the upper or lower floor—helps in achieving a balanced coverage across both levels. This strategic placement prevents dead zones in different areas of the home, ensuring a seamless internet experience throughout.

How Do You Choose the Best AC 1900 Extender for Your Needs?
The coverage area is another important factor; check the specifications to see how many square feet the extender can effectively cover. This is especially vital if you have a large home or specific areas where Wi-Fi is weak.
Speed specifications are usually highlighted as AC 1900, but it’s important to know that this is a theoretical maximum. Real-world performance can differ based on distance, interference, and network congestion, so read reviews to gauge practical speeds.
Ease of setup varies widely among extenders, with some offering straightforward plug-and-play functionality while others may require more complex configurations. Look for options that provide mobile apps or simple web interfaces to simplify the installation process.
Lastly, additional features can enhance the functionality of your extender. Dual-band extenders can distribute traffic more effectively, while Ethernet ports allow for wired connections to devices that require stable connectivity, such as gaming consoles or smart TVs.
